Joseph Guo

Qijian Guo developed initial board support for the FRDM-IMX91 platform in the flipperdevices/u-boot repository, focusing on device tree configuration and DDR memory initialization. He implemented device tree entries to enable peripheral connectivity and power management, and created DDR support for both 1GB and 2GB configurations, including timing scripts and initialization routines. Working primarily in C and dts, Qijian applied his expertise in Linux kernel and device driver development to ensure robust hardware interfacing for embedded systems. The work addressed the need for reliable board bring-up, providing a foundation for further development and documentation within the embedded Linux ecosystem.
